If having a PCI card is not a necessity then I reckon you should go for a
SoundBlaster AWE 64. Cheap as chips, well proven record. I've used mine
with RH 5.2 and Mandrake 6.0. The most I ever needed to do to get it
running is to run sndconfig twice. I don't know if all the bells and
whistles of SB Live work under Linux. IF they don't I wouldn't imagine
there to be a huge performance difference between the flashy PCI cards and
the AWE 64. Of course I might be wrong on the last bit (anyone know any
different?)
I can't remember if sound is configured during installation. If it isn't
just run setup from the console, or an xterm window, and choose sound. IF
you don't have a good old fashioned ISA sound card, what are you going to do
with those three empty, never going to be used for anything else, ISA slots?
